Users of Precious List may sign up to our service to help manage, catalogue, and document valuable items for insurance or bequeathment  purposes. They are able to share this information with their insurance broker and/or lawyer exclusively via the web application.

The device app (for example for iOs or Android device) allows users to manage items on the go, in particular utilising the device camera and photo library to directly take photos of particular items they wish to document. 

Users do not purchase content or functionality in the device app, which is a companion to the browser app to help people to quickly add and view items in their collections. Full functionality is only available in the browser app.

Lawyers

Probate lawyers and estate planners can be invited to a users’ account as a collaborator.  With this access they can help a user plan for the disposal of their listed possessions to their wishes. 

Precious Lists can collect the details that will be needed to identify and contact a beneficiary. In the event that their services are needed, the professional with authority can log in and view the details of the stored items.

Valuers

Collectors of art with significant value need to keep the current value up to date.  Some art experts and galleries offer valuation services that can be done as a ‘desktop valuation’ based on the information available. 

Logging into a Precious Lists account of a customer allows them access to pictures, details and provenance documents in order to provide an opinion on the current value.

Personal Cataloguers

Busy people may not have to the time to complete an inventory of their art collection or possessions. 

Personal Cataloguers can provide this service by being allowed editor access as a ‘collaborator’ to Precious Lists by the owner.  They can then spend the time required to add and edit a detailed inventory of the collection.

Insurers

Insurance premiums are set on the value of items insured. Precious Lists allows users to enter the value of their precious items and record if an item is specifically insured with their insurer. 

The insurer (for example the broker) can be allowed collaborator access to look at the current value of the items and determine which should be specifically named in an insurance policy.
